# Delete a network volume

> Delete a network volume. Use this API reference to review authentication, request parameters, response fields, and errors for this Runpod operation.

paths:
  /networkvolumes/{networkVolumeId}:
    delete:
      tags:
        - network volumes
      summary: Delete a network volume
      description: >-
        Delete a network volume. Use this API reference to review
        authentication, request parameters, response fields, and errors for this
        Runpod operation.
      operationId: DeleteNetworkVolume
      parameters:
        - name: networkVolumeId
          in: path
          description: Network volume ID to delete.
          required: true
          schema:
            type: string
      responses:
        '204':
          description: Network volume successfully deleted.
        '400':
          description: Invalid network volume ID.
        '401':
          description: Unauthorized.
